R S - 4 8 4 / R S - 2 3 2 C O N N E C T I O N

Used as a Direct COM port connection, a single point connection using an RS-232 from the

computer into a multi-point communication network using an RS-485 converter. E-Mon

RS-485 converters allows a connection to the recorder(s) and meter (s). RS-485 is a multi-

drop communication link with a speed range of 2,400 bits per second to 19,200 bits per

second

S E N S O R S

Measurement device that detects the energy flow (magnetic field) through the metal core.

The volume of energy flow is converted to voltage and relays to the metering chip for

calculating energy and various factors.

S E T O F S E N S O R S

Some E-Mon meters are capable of supporting multiple sets of sensors in parallel. This

feature allows a single meter to monitor more than one circuit.

S C A N N I N G

E-Mon Energy™ has the scan feature to automatically query the recorders/meters in the

system. Once a new device is detected, you have the option of adding it to the database.

S T A T I S T I C S T A B L E

The table that populates with the demand data used to plot the graphs (i.e. Total KWh, Avg.

KW, Peak, Peak Time ,WHrs).

S L I D I N G W I N D O W

E-Mon Energy’s set time interval that is derived from a predefined number of sub-intervals,

each at a specified time.

T

T A X ( % )

Added to the E-Mon Energy rate table as recover fees by the utility company, state or

municipal regulation. Based on a percentage of the net energy cost.
